    Overall, this Hermes is in excellent condition. The cosmetic condition is excellent however it has some small spots of wear, especially on the bottom (see photo of base). The chrome and aluminum are in top condition with no signs of corrosion. The typing keys are clean and unmarked by use. Both platen roller knobs are absolutely solid.  The small round knob (carriage release knob) has a black spot in the photos. This is an ink smudge (my dirty fingers) and will be removed.

    Mechanically, it is in superb working condition. The paper feeder rollers are in perfect condition and soft. The feet are in excellent condition, soft and still grip the desktop well. All mechanical devices (including, but not exclusive of, the ribbon colour selection mechanism, ribbon advance and reverse mechanisms, margin release, etc.) have been checked and adjusted as necessary, and work as originally manufactured. Everything on this typewriter is original to its manufacture and original purchase.

    The case/cover is in excellent condition. The chrome pieces are shiny and bright and the handle is clean and intact. The interior is in near-perfect condition with all chrome pieces unblemished. At some point the handle ends have been over-taped with a strong, chrome tape. I am not sure why that was done. I decided to not change it as the handle is strong and looks fine.

    The keyboard is English QWERTY with extra Spanish keys and accent keys for foreign languages. The typeface is Hermes Pica (10 c.p.i.). Based on the serial number this machine was manufactured in 1959.
